Overview of Sugar Beet and Sugar Cane
Sugar beet and sugar cane are 2 main sources of sucrose, each with one-of-a-kind characteristics and farming methods. Sugar beet, a root veggie, thrives in warm climates and is frequently expanded in areas with cooler temperatures. It has a high sugar web content, commonly about 16 to 20 percent, which is drawn out with a procedure of slicing and diffusion. In comparison, sugar cane is an exotic yard that prospers in cozy, humid climates. Its stalks can include 10 to 15 percent sucrose, and the removal process normally involves squashing the stalks to release the juice.Both crops play considerable duties in the worldwide sugar sector, with sugar beet primarily grown in Europe and North America, while sugar cane is primarily grown in countries like Brazil, India, and China. Dirt Demands Contrast
While both sugar beet and sugar cane are important sources of sugar, their dirt requirements show distinctive choices that influence cultivation approaches and expanding conditions. Sugar beets flourish in well-drained, loamy soils rich in raw material, with a pH range of 6.0 to 8.0. This kind of dirt sustains their deep taproots, making it possible for vitamins and mineral absorption. On the other hand, sugar cane likes productive, sandy loam or clay soils that maintain dampness, ideally with a pH between 6.0 and 7.5. The root system of sugar cane is more comprehensive, requiring dirt that can sustain its growth in a more water-retentive setting. These varying dirt needs demand tailored agricultural techniques to maximize returns for every crop, highlighting the significance of soil management in their cultivation.

Harvesting Techniques Review
Gathering techniques for sugar beet and sugar cane differ substantially because of their distinct farming techniques and expanding problems. Sugar beet is normally harvested mechanically making use of specific equipment that roots out the plants and separates the origins from the foliage. This process is normally performed in cooler months to stop perishing. In contrast, sugar cane harvesting usually involves manual work or mechanical cutters, where stalks are cut short. This strategy is performed during the dry period to decrease the wetness web content, which can affect sugar yield. Furthermore, the timing of the harvest is essential, as both crops need to be gathered when they get to peak sugar focus for reliable handling.
Geographical Distribution and Production Data
Both sugar beet and sugar cane serve as important resources of sucrose, their geographic distribution and production data reveal noteworthy distinctions. Sugar cane mainly flourishes in exotic and subtropical environments, with major production locations consisting of Brazil, India, China, and Thailand. On the other hand, sugar beet is chiefly cultivated in pleasant areas, with leading producers located in Europe, the United States, and Russia.According to current data, global sugar cane manufacturing significantly exceeds that of sugar beet. In 2021, sugar cane accounted for about 79% of complete sugar manufacturing worldwide, while sugar beet contributed around 21%. Brazil remains the world's biggest sugar manufacturer, generally from sugar cane, creating over 38 million metric tons each year. Environmental Factors To Consider in Sugar Production
Although sugar production from both sugar beet and sugar cane supplies economic advantages, it additionally elevates considerable environmental problems. The growing of these plants usually entails considerable land usage, which can cause environment damage and loss of biodiversity. Furthermore, using fertilizers and pesticides in sugar farming adds to dirt degradation and water air pollution, impacting neighborhood ecosystems.The high water usage needed for irrigation, specifically in sugar cane production, aggravates water scarcity concerns in some regions. Deforestation for increasing sugar cane plantations has been connected to raised greenhouse gas emissions, additionally adding to climate change.Sustainable farming practices, such as crop turning and natural farming, are vital to alleviate these ecological impacts. What Are the Byproducts of Sugar Beet and Sugar Cane Handling?
The by-products of sugar beet and sugar cane handling consist of molasses, bagasse, and pulp (Sugar beet vs sugar cane). These products are used in animal feed, biofuel manufacturing, and numerous commercial applications, enhancing sustainability and decreasing waste in the sugar industry
